An electric van is a type of commercial vehicle that runs primarily or entirely on electricity instead of traditional fossil fuels. These vans utilize electric motors and rechargeable batteries for propulsion, offering advantages such as lower emissions, reduced operating costs, and quieter operation compared to vans powered by internal combustion engines. They are increasingly favored for urban delivery services and other commercial uses where reducing environmental impact is important.

Electric vans are typically powered by battery electric vehicles (BEV), fuel cell electric vehicles (FCEV), or pl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EV). Battery electric vehicles (BEV) operate solely on electricity stored in rechargeable batteries, without any internal combustion engine. These batteries commonly use materials such as nickel, manganese, cobalt, and lithium-ion, with capacities ranging from under 50 kWh to over 50 kWh. They offer varying ranges tailored to different applications, including up to 100 miles, 100-200 miles, and over 200 miles, suitable for sectors such as last-mile delivery, refrigerated transport, field services, and distribution.

The electric van market size has grown exponentially in recent years. It will grow from $16.51 billion in 2023 to $20.79 billion in 2024 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 26%. During the historic period, growth can be credited to governmental initiatives, improvements in charging infrastructure, increased public and corporate awareness of climate change and environmental sustainability, greater adoption by businesses seeking to decrease their carbon footprint, and lower operational costs compared to internal combustion engine (ICE) vans, including savings on fuel and maintenance. Additionally, the introduction of low-emission zones in cities has played a significant role.

The electric van market size is expected to see exponential growth in the next few years. It will grow to $52.61 billion in 2028 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 26.1%. The anticipated growth in forecast period is driven by ongoing and potentially expanded government incentives and subsidies for electric vehicles, declining production costs due to scale in manufacturing and maturing supply chains, a rising number of businesses establishing ambitious carbon neutrality goals, significant investments in expanding and upgrading charging networks - such as ultra-fast chargers - and advancements in wireless and mobile charging solutions. Moreover, the growth is supported by the increasing use of renewable energy sources to reduce the carbon footprint of EV charging. Key trends expected include the development of solid-state batteries, advancements in battery technology, the proliferation of ultra-fast charging stations and wireless charging options, integration of advanced driver-assistance systems, and the evolution of connected vehicle technologies enabling real-time data exchange.

The increasing demand for logistics and e-commerce is poised to drive growth in the electric van market moving forward. Logistics and e-commerce involve managing and executing the flow of goods, services, and information in online retail, from order placement to delivery. This trend is fueled by rising consumer expectations for convenient, fast, and reliable online shopping and delivery services. Electric vans play a crucial role in this sector by reducing delivery costs and environmental impact while enhancing efficiency in urban deliveries. For instance, according to the United States Census Bureau in May 2024, U.S. retail e-commerce sales for the first quarter of 2024 reached $289.2 billion, marking a 2.1 percent (±0.7%) increase from the fourth quarter of 2023. This underscores the growing influence of logistics and e-commerce in shaping the electric van market.

Key players in the electric van market are concentrating on developing commercial and fleet electric vans equipped with battery-electric vehicle systems to improve sustainability and operational efficiency in commercial transportation. These electric-powered vehicles are tailored for business purposes such as goods delivery and service operations, offering advantages such as lower operating costs and reduced environmental footprint. For instance, Ram Trucks launched the Ram ProMaster electric van (EV) in January 2024, a significant step in their electrification efforts. The ProMaster EV boasts a targeted city driving range of up to 162 miles and is powered by a standard 110-kilowatt-hour (kWh) battery pack. It supports Level 3 DC fast charging options ranging from 50 kW to 150 kW, along with a Level 2 wall box charger up to 11 kW. The cargo van configuration can handle payloads up to 3,020 pounds, while the delivery model accommodates 2,030 pounds of payload.

In April 2024, CMA CGM acquired a 10% stake in Flexis SAS, a joint venture between Renault Group and Volvo Group focused on electric van development, enhancing its logistics capabilities for last-mile parcel delivery. This strategic investment underscores CMA CGM's commitment to expanding its logistics business with electric van technology from Flexis SAS, a France-based manufacturer specializing in electric vans.
